What are Malai kofta balls made of?
Malai Kofta is a very popular Indian vegetarian dish where balls (kofta) made of potato and paneer are deep fried and served with a creamy and spiced tomato based curry. The literal translation of this dish is malai=creamy/buttery and kofta=spiced balls (in this case made of potatoes and paneer).

What does kofta mean in Indian?
It is said that the word kofta comes from the term ‘koftan’ which means ‘to pound’ or ‘to grind’. This basically means the ground meat used for meatballs. In India, koftas can be both vegetarian and non-vegetarian. It is usually cooked in a spicy gravy and eaten with rice or roti.

Is paneer a cottage cheese?
Paneer, a semisolid, cubed form of cottage cheese, is favored in the north and east India. “Paneer”—literally “cheese” in Hindi—readily takes on the flavor of the spices in which it cooks. Paneer adds a rich and creamy flavor to Indian desserts, such as Sandesh, rasgulla, and rasmalai.
